Mold behind kitchen cabinets is often hidden until the cabinets or wall materials are removed.
If drywall or other porous wall materials behind your kitchen cabinets become wet and cannot be properly dried, removal may be necessary. Trapped moisture can create the conditions for significant hidden mold growth—just like what we found on this project.
Our remediation process follows IICRC S520 professional mold remediation standards, including proper containment, removal of affected materials, HEPA cleaning, and treatment of the exposed structure.
